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" rating for Tencent Holdings [5] Core Views - Tencent is focusing on AI iteration, with its app "Tencent Yuanbao" ranking among the top three AI native apps in China, achieving 41.64 million MAU as of March 2025 [1] - The company reported a steady revenue growth of approximately 660.3 billion RMB for 2024, a year-on-year increase of 8%, with a gross margin improvement from 48% in 2023 to 53% in 2024 [1][2] - Non-GAAP net profit for 2024 is estimated at around 222.7 billion RMB, reflecting a 41% year-on-year growth [1] Summary by Sections Financial Performance - In 2024, Tencent's domestic game revenue grew by 10% to 139.7 billion RMB, driven by popular titles such as "Valorant" and "League of Legends Mobile" [2] - Advertising revenue increased by 20% year-on-year to 121.4 billion RMB, while financial technology and enterprise services revenue grew by 4% to 212.0 billion RMB [2] AI Development - Tencent's capital expenditure reached 76.76 billion RMB in 2024, indicating a strong commitment to AI development [2] - The company has invested heavily in self-developed foundational models, achieving top rankings on multiple platforms in 2024 [2] - Daily active users (DAU) for Tencent Yuanbao surged 20 times in early 2024, positioning it as the third-largest AI application [2] Future Projections - Revenue projections for Tencent are estimated at 719.2 billion RMB for 2025, with non-GAAP net profit expected to be around 249.4 billion RMB [3] - The report sets a target price of 566 HKD for Tencent, corresponding to a 20x P/E ratio for 2025 [3]
